Honda don't expect departure to hinder Tsunoda's opportunities

According to Honda top executive Masashi Yamamoto, the departure of his company from Formula 1 will not affect Yuki Tsunoda's future in the sport. The young Japanese's chances of a debut next year seem to be reduced by the departure of Honda. Rumours have been circulating for some time that next year Tsunoda will replace Daniil Kvyat at AlphaTauri under pressure from engine supplier Honda. The Japanese company would like to see a Japanese rider in the sport again, but because of their departure it remains to be seen whether this will happen. Departure has no influence.
